Paso 8: Aplicación de Inteligencia Artificial a Chefbot usando Python
En esta sección, puedes ver cómo hacer el robot interactivo añadiendo algún tipo de inteligencia. Estamos utilizando AIML (Inteligencia Artificial Mark-up Language) y su extensión de Python llamado PyAIML para hacer el robot interactivo.
Aquí estamos convertir la voz a texto y entrada en el AIML, después de conseguir el texto de salida de AIML, podemos convertirlo en discurso usando TTS. El diagrama de bloques de este proceso se muestra en la galería de imágenes.
También he construido un paquete ROS para la manipulación de archivo AIML y también se da el diagrama de bloque del paquete de rosaiml .
Usted recibirá el código completo del código que ya hemos reproducido. Para obtener archivos de ejercicio, usted debe comprobar los códigos de libro.